Brake discs, also known as rotors, are the metal discs attached to your car’s wheels. They work in conjunction with the brake pads to create friction, slowing down the rotation of the wheels and ultimately bringing your car to a halt. The size of the brake discs directly impacts their ability to dissipate heat generated during braking, which is crucial for maintaining consistent braking performance, especially during repeated hard stops. Larger brake discs offer a greater surface area for heat dissipation, leading to improved braking performance and reduced risk of brake fade.

Factors Influencing Brake Disc Size

Several factors contribute to the size of brake discs on a particular car model. These factors are often interconnected and work together to optimize the braking system for the vehicle’s intended use and performance characteristics.

1. Vehicle Weight

Heavier vehicles require larger brake discs to effectively handle the increased mass. The greater the weight, the more force is needed to decelerate the vehicle, and larger discs provide a larger surface area for the brake pads to clamp onto, generating the necessary stopping power.

2. Engine Power and Performance

High-performance vehicles with powerful engines often have larger brake discs to cope with the increased braking demands generated by their acceleration capabilities. These vehicles frequently experience higher speeds and require more robust braking systems to ensure safe and controlled stops.

3. Driving Conditions

Vehicles designed for specific driving conditions, such as off-roading or towing, may have larger brake discs to handle the additional stress and weight. Off-road vehicles often encounter rough terrain and require more powerful brakes to navigate challenging situations, while towing vehicles need larger discs to effectively slow down the combined weight of the vehicle and the trailer.

4. Safety Regulations

Safety regulations and standards set by government agencies often dictate minimum brake disc sizes for different vehicle categories. These regulations ensure a baseline level of braking performance for all vehicles, contributing to overall road safety.

How to Determine the Size of Your Brake Discs

Knowing the size of your brake discs is essential for purchasing replacement parts and ensuring proper fitment. Here are several methods to determine the size of your car’s brake discs: (See Also: What Does I P Brake Light Mean? Car Safety Explained)

1. Consult Your Owner’s Manual

The most reliable source of information about your car’s brake discs is your owner’s manual. It typically lists the specific dimensions of the front and rear brake discs, along with other important braking system details.

2. Check the Disc Itself

If you have access to your car’s wheels, you can visually inspect the brake discs. The size is usually stamped or etched onto the disc itself. Look for markings indicating the diameter and thickness of the disc.

3. Use an Online Lookup Tool

Many automotive parts retailers and online resources offer lookup tools that allow you to enter your car’s make, model, and year to retrieve information about your brake discs. These tools can be convenient for quickly finding the correct size.

4. Contact a Mechanic or Parts Specialist

If you’re unsure about the size of your brake discs, you can always consult a trusted mechanic or parts specialist. They have the expertise and resources to accurately determine the correct size for your vehicle.

Understanding Brake Disc Sizes

Brake disc sizes are typically expressed in millimeters (mm) and represent the diameter of the disc. The thickness of the disc is also important, as it affects its durability and heat dissipation capabilities.

For example, a brake disc size of 300mm x 25mm indicates a diameter of 300mm and a thickness of 25mm. Larger diameter discs generally offer improved braking performance due to their increased surface area.

The following table provides a general overview of common brake disc sizes found on various vehicle types: (See Also: Which Brake Is Used in Car? Types Explained)

Vehicle Type Front Brake Disc Size (mm) Rear Brake Disc Size (mm)
Compact Car 260-280 240-260
Mid-Size Sedan 280-300 260-280
SUV 300-350 300-330
Sports Car 320-380 300-340
Luxury Car 340-400 320-360

Please note that these are just general guidelines, and actual brake disc sizes can vary significantly depending on the specific vehicle model and year.

The Importance of Proper Brake Disc Size

Choosing the correct brake disc size for your vehicle is crucial for optimal braking performance, safety, and overall driving experience.

1. Braking Performance

Larger brake discs offer a greater surface area for the brake pads to clamp onto, generating more friction and providing improved stopping power. This is especially important for vehicles with high horsepower or those frequently driven in demanding conditions.

2. Heat Dissipation

Brake discs generate significant heat during braking, and larger discs have a greater surface area for heat dissipation. This helps prevent brake fade, a condition where the brakes lose effectiveness due to excessive heat buildup.

3. Handling and Stability

Properly sized brake discs contribute to improved handling and stability by providing consistent braking force. This is essential for maintaining control of the vehicle, especially during emergency maneuvers.

4. Safety

Choosing the correct brake disc size is a fundamental aspect of vehicle safety. Larger discs enhance braking performance and reduce the risk of accidents by providing reliable stopping power in all situations.

Frequently Asked Questions

What happens if I use brake discs that are too small?

Using brake discs that are too small for your vehicle can lead to several issues, including reduced braking performance, increased stopping distances, and a higher risk of brake fade. The smaller surface area will struggle to dissipate heat effectively, leading to reduced braking efficiency and potential brake failure.

Can I upgrade my brake discs to larger sizes?

Yes, you can often upgrade your brake discs to larger sizes. However, it’s essential to ensure compatibility with your vehicle’s braking system and wheel size. Upgrading to larger discs may also require modifications to your calipers, brake lines, and other components. How often should I replace my brake discs?

The lifespan of brake discs varies depending on driving habits, conditions, and vehicle usage. Generally, brake discs should be inspected regularly, and replacement is recommended when they show signs of wear, such as grooves, scoring, or excessive thickness reduction.

What are the signs of worn brake discs?

Signs of worn brake discs include:

  • Squealing or grinding noises when braking
  • Vibrations in the steering wheel or brake pedal
  • Reduced braking performance
  • Visible grooves, scoring, or thinning of the disc surface

If you experience any of these symptoms, it’s essential to have your brake discs inspected by a qualified mechanic.
